Girls’ Cricket Development Course - 8-13 Year Olds

Kent U19 Girls skipper Natalie Lane

The Kent Cricket Board is pleased to welcome young girls to enrol on this special indoor, four week course starting in the new year.

“This new style course involves much more than pure cricket skills,” says David Sear, Kent Cricket Development Officer. “There will be lots of activity which we call ‘FUNdamentals’ – movement, co-ordination and body awareness, as well as striking and fielding games. It’s all part of a new approach to the long term development of future cricketers. The emphasis is on FUN and it is aimed particularly at the young.”

Girls may come with friends and it does not matter how experienced they are – clubs, players and beginners – all are welcome. Soft balls and Kwik Cricket equipment will be used

There are many more opportunities for girls to play cricket nowadays, and girls who show potential may also be invited to join the Kent Under 11 and Under 13 squad coaching.
